Mastercam seeks a Software Engineer II (Desktop to Cloud Integration & SDK Connectivity) who is respon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ining cloud-enabled services and integration capabilities that extend and enhance the Mastercam platform. Working within a large-scale commercial codebase, this role applies modern software engineering practices and technologies to solve complex technical challenges while supporting Mastercam's desktop-to-cloud evolution.
As Mastercam continues to expand its hybrid desktop and cloud architecture, this position plays a key role in developing cloud services, enabling reliable communication between desktop and web-based systems, and extending SDK and API capabilities to support modern integration scenarios. The role requires collaboration across engineering teams to establish scalable integration patterns, improve interoperability, and ensure a seamless user and developer experience.
The Software Engineer II proactively owns complex technical initiatives, contributes to the design and implementation of large-scale projects, and provides expertise within the team's domain. This position supports Mastercam's global developer ecosystem and helps maintain the company's leadership in CAD/CAM, API, SDK, and extensibility technologies.

Sandvik is a global, high-tech engineering group providing solutions that enhance productivity, profitability and sustainability for the manufacturing, mining and infrastructure industries. We are at the forefront of digitalization and focus on optimizing our customers’ processes. Our world-leading offering includes equipment, tools, services and digital solutions for machining, mining, rock excavation and rock processing. In 2024, the Sandvik Group had approximately 41,000 employees, sales in more than 150 countries and revenues of about SEK 123 billion.
